Why Timing is Crucial for Going Viral on TikTok Overnight
When a creator posts a video on TikTok, the timing of that post can significantly impact its chances of going viral overnight. For example, a video posted during peak hours, such as 3-5 pm EST, is more likely to get noticed by a larger audience, increasing its potential to spread rapidly and become a viral sensation. This is because many users are actively scrolling through their feeds during this time, making it easier for a well-crafted video to catch their attention and gain traction.
